Introduction

Creating DIY wooden pool steps can enhance the accessibility and beauty of your pool area. These custom steps not only provide safe entry and exit but also add a personal touch to your outdoor space. When planning your DIY wooden pool steps, consider the following aspects:
  • Materials: Using high-quality, treated wood ensures durability and resistance to water damage.
  • Design: Tailor the design to fit your pool's dimensions and your personal style. Whether you prefer a simple ladder style or a more elaborate design, the options are plentiful.
  • Safety: Incorporate non-slip surfaces to prevent accidents, especially when the steps are wet.
  • Maintenance: Regularly check for wear and tear to maintain the integrity of your wooden steps.
